程 超 莊 艷
[摘要]從電子監察平臺的總體設計、系統架構設計、關鍵技術設計等幾個方面闡述青島市綜合電子監察平臺的建設思路。通過綜合電子監察平臺的建設,達到提高政府行政效能、加強監察力度的效果。
[關鍵詞]電子監察總體設計架構技術
中圖分類號:TP3文獻標識碼:A文章編號:1671-7597(2009)0210114-01
綜合電子監察平臺的應用,可以實現紀檢監察機關對權力運行中心的實時監督監管,提高工作效率,使監察人員便捷掌握全市的權力運行的違規異常等情況,集中時間和精力去履行督查、督辦職能。
一、綜合行政監察平臺的總體設計
綜合電子監察系統共分為四大功能部分:
(一)綜合行政電子監察平臺。綜合行政電子監察平臺是構建各類專項行政監察系統的基礎。各類專項行政監察可以在此平臺基礎上建立,經過配置和定制實現專項業務監察。監察平臺可以為領導和工作人員提供實時的監控、查詢等管理手段,同時為領導決策和行政監察績效評估提供業務和數據支撐。監察平臺還可以提供預警糾錯、信息服務機制,幫助被監察對象及早發現問題,解決問題。
(二)行政監察績效考核系統。行政效能監察的考評與獎懲,是實現行政效能監察工作有效性的強制與激勵機制。通過考評,以充分的證據和依據,對行政效能狀況加以確認。通過設立考核方案,明確評測點、評測指標、計算公式,利用監察平臺提供的數據,既客觀公正,又不失靈活,客觀地對被監察對象進行評估和考核。
(三)行政投訴監察系統。行政效能投訴系統提供一個公眾對被監察對象進行投訴的平臺,該平臺通過實現外網受理、內網辦理、外網反饋形成集中統一行政效能投訴機制。行政效能投訴平臺還提供了公眾直接與被監察對象進行對話的渠道,在不脫離監察局監控的情況下,直接同被監察對象進行溝通。
(四)綜合監察信息交換平臺。綜合監察信息交換平臺實現跨部門、異構系統、異構數據庫之間的信息交換和共享。通過梳理確定各部門信息資源共享數據目錄、共享方式,在不影響各部門業務運轉的前提下,實現跨部門、異構系統、異構數據庫之間的信息交換和共享,建立全市統一、動態更新的法人、自然人、證照信息、基礎地理信息等基礎數據庫,為各部門執法尤其是聯合執法提供信息共享服務。
二、綜合監察系統架構設計
(一)多層結構。系統采用,NET技術的多層體系結構,主要包括數據層、業務邏輯層和表示層。
數據層:由數據庫系統組成,可以支持Ms SOLSERVER、ORACLE,建議采用MS SOLSERVER系統,主要處理數據對象操作;業務邏輯層:由一系列處理業務邏輯的類庫組成,運行在,NET FRAMWORK2.0的IIS6.0上;表示層:使用Aspx、Html、Xml等技術完成界面展示和與用戶的交互,用JavaScript處理了部分邏輯處理;客戶端主要使用IE6.0瀏覽器系統進行業務處理。
(二)應用框架。應用程序開發是基于應用程序框架,基于應用框架開發應用可以復用組件、提高開發效率、規范設計,對于提高應用系統的質量和開發速度有很大的幫助。我們的程序框架包括:工具包、安全平臺、WEB應用框架三個部分。
三、關鍵技術設計
(一)適應多級監察體系的技術設計。綜合電子監察系統在建設的時候從以下幾個技術方面適應多級監察體系:
1.目錄服務技術實現組織機構的多級管理。綜合監察系統的組織機構利用目錄服務技術,可以按照樹狀結構建立組織機構體系,并且支持組織機構的合并、拆分、掛接、獨立等操作,使綜合監察系統既可以在一個單獨的單位運行,也可以在一個復雜的組織機構內運行,并且可以與其他組織機構發生聯系。
系統的人員信息、組織機構信息、應用程序角色信息等放置在微軟的活動目錄中,實現了用戶信息的分布式存儲和分級管理。由于目錄技術的采用,系統作為一個擴展性極強的系統,可以方便地將一個部門的應用擴展到一個龐大組織機構的應用。
2.信息交換技術實現各級監察業務的松耦合。由于采用信息交換技術實現異步處理機制,監察業務可以在一個單位內,也可以在多級組織機構內進行。利用的信息交換平臺,能夠用統一的方式,支持不同的平臺,實現各系統之間不同結構和格式的數據的相互轉換。信息交換對于通過WebService向應用提供信息交換服務。各種應用可以利用信息交換的客戶端進行適當配置,就可以實現系統之間數據的交換。
(二)適應多變監察業務流程的技術設計。由于監察業務流程可能經常會發生變化,因此,綜合監察系統在設計上采用工作流引擎技術,將復雜的業務流程利用工作流引擎加以管理。
1.預設多種工作流模板。通過監察業務分析,可以抽象出若干基本工作流程,這些工作流程可以滿足大部分業務流程的需要。綜合電子監察平臺預設了對應的工作流作為模板,在定義監察業務的時候可以直接采用預設的工作流模板,從而可以便捷的設計業務流程。
2.根據監察業務流程的不同設計工作流。在預設工作流模板不能滿足要求的情況下,工作流引擎提供圖形化的流程設計器自定義工作流。若業務流程發生變化,只需要利用工作流引擎對業務流程進行圖形化的調整就能予以適應。當流程的環節發生變化時,流程重新部署,對已運轉得流程數據不會影響,仍然按照原來的變化前的環節來運轉,對于新建立的業務則要按照新的流程來進行流轉。
(三)適應多變監察業務數據與表現形式的技術設計。政策及業務的發展的變化最有可能就是體現在業務信息的載體表單。表單的變化主要是業務表單增加了數據項、減少了數據項以及界面發生變化。那么當這些變化發生時,可以通過表單引擎提供的表單定制工具進行相應的修改,重新部署。
另外一類表單發生變化是針對表單的操作發生了變化。例如新增了審核、查重功能。那么這種變化主要是通過本地操作管理增加相應的操作,再通過表單定制將新增加的操作綁定到表單上,最后通過表單的重新部署實現操作的變化。
四、結束語
建設電子監察系統的意義在于提高政府行政效能;加強行政效能監察力度,促進政務透明;改革和創新政府行政管理活動的模式;同時也是對國家大力提倡的建設和諧社會的有利回應。
作者簡介:
程超,男,河北滄州,中國海洋大學信息科學與工程學院在職研究生,青島市電子政務辦公室軟件處工程師,研究方向:計算機技術。